Green Methanol Market Overview
The green methanol market pertains to the manufacturing as well as distribution of methanol (CH3OH) from renewable, non-fossil fuel sources. In contrast to conventional methanol production from natural gas, green methanol is produced through renewable feedstock, e.g., biomass (agricultural waste, forestry residues), biogas, captured carbon dioxide (CO2), and renewable electricity through electrolysis to produce 'green hydrogen', which then reacts with CO2. This is a mainly productive means for considerable reduction in greenhouse gas emissions and contributes well towards a circular and green chemical industry.
Green methanol is identical in chemical structure to conventional methanol and can replace all of its applications as is. Such applications are broad, including use for marine fuels for domestic consumption and power generation, feedstock for other chemicals and plastics, and direct blending with gasoline.

2025 Emerging Trends in Green Methanol Industry
A major trend is the increasing investment in production facilities utilising various sustainable feedstocks like biomass, captured CO2, and green hydrogen. Moreover, strategic partnerships between energy producers, shipping companies, and technology partners are becoming more common with the objective of securing supply chains and fast-tracking the acceptance of green methanol as a clean fuel alternative.
Another growing trend is the increased focus on technological improvements for better production efficiencies and lower costs of green methanol. Carbon capture, renewable hydrogen making by electrolysis, and methanol synthesis developments are fundamental to the efforts of making green methanol more affordable against its fossil-derived alternatives. Furthermore, several government policies and incentives, as well as the establishment of carbon pricing frameworks in different regions, are key drivers of market growth and attracting further investments into this fast-paced sector.

Key Challenges Facing the Green Methanol Market in 2025
The challenges faced by the green methanol market include primarily the higher production costs and supply limitations. Green methanol production is inherently more costly than the fossil fuel-based methods of production due to the high prices of hydrogen production through electrolysis, coupled with renewable energy inputs. This cost gap is very likely to continue for the foreseeable future, meaning that, without major policy support, cost subsidies, or carbon-price mechanisms, green methanol will have a severe disadvantage in the marketplace. On top of that, the very limited current supply situation with green methanol, given the production capacity is far below the burgeoning demand, has caused shortages, which have even led some industries to turn back to alternative fuels like LNG.
Infrastructure and scalability remain hurdles to the market. Existing storage and distribution infrastructure for methanol at large-scale adaptation may have to undergo drastic changes for green methanol, whereas improvements still have to be made for carbon capture, hydrogen production, and methanol synthesis to augment productivity and lower costs. The toxicity and flammability of methanol and its lower energy density compared to conventional fuels heighten the complexity of its adoption in certain applications like shipping due to safety and handling considerations.

Competitive Landscape
The competition environment of the green methanol market is still quite immature today, developing almost at a breakneck speed. It comprises, on one side, established methanol manufacturers converting to green methods and, on the other end, the new-in-market players dealing exclusively with green methanol. Critical competition determinants include price efficacy in production; access to sustainable feedstock biomass, captured CO2 and green hydrogen; as well as innovative technological prowess in production processes and the ability to tie up future offtake agreements with end-user sectors like chemicals and shipping.
The mega players are tying up in strategic alliances, supporting R&D for economically and competitively viable production technologies (for instance, those linked to biomass gasification or CO2 hydrogenation), and developing infrastructure for storage and transport. Also, differentiation occurs on the basis of sustainability certificates and fulfilling increasing market requirements from decarbonising industries. Some of the prominent companies in that segment are OCI, Methanex, and Carbon Recycling International (CRI), with several players exploring regional opportunities and specific feedstock advantages.
